Why Blood Sugar Fluctuations Matter

Uncontrolled blood sugar fluctuations can lead to various health complications. High blood sugar (hyperglycemia) can cause damage to blood vessels, nerves, and organs over time, increasing the risk of heart disease, kidney disease, vision problems, and nerve damage (neuropathy). Conversely, low blood sugar (hypoglycemia) can result in dizziness, confusion, and even loss of consciousness if left untreated.

For people with diabetes, managing these fluctuations is paramount. But even for those without diabetes, understanding the factors that influence blood sugar can aid in preventing the onset of the condition and maintaining optimal health.


1. Sleep Quality and Duration

The Sleep-Blood Sugar Connection

Sleep quality and duration play a pivotal role in regulating hormones that affect blood sugar levels. During sleep, the body releases hormones like cortisol and growth hormone, which can influence insulin sensitivity and glucose metabolism. Poor sleep, whether it's due to insomnia, sleep apnea, or simply not getting enough hours, can disrupt this delicate hormonal balance.

How Poor Sleep Impacts Blood Sugar:

  • Increased Insulin Resistance: Lack of sleep can make your cells less responsive to insulin, requiring your pancreas to produce more insulin to achieve the same effect.
  • Elevated Cortisol Levels: Sleep deprivation triggers the release of cortisol, a stress hormone that can increase blood sugar levels.
  • Increased Hunger and Cravings: Insufficient sleep can alter hunger hormones like ghrelin and leptin, leading to increased appetite, particularly for sugary and carbohydrate-rich foods.

Research Data:

Numerous studies have demonstrated a clear link between sleep and blood sugar control. For example, a study published in the Journal of the American Medical Association found that even one night of sleep deprivation can significantly impair glucose metabolism. Another study in Diabetes Care showed that individuals who consistently slept less than six hours per night had a higher risk of developing type 2 diabetes.

Practical Tips:

  • Aim for 7-9 hours of quality sleep each night.
  • Establish a consistent sleep schedule. Go to bed and wake up at the same time each day, even on weekends.
  • Create a relaxing bedtime routine. This might include a warm bath, reading, or practicing relaxation techniques.
  • Optimize your sleep environment. Make sure your bedroom is dark, quiet, and cool.
  • Address sleep disorders. If you suspect you have a sleep disorder like sleep apnea, consult a healthcare professional.

2. Stress Levels

The Stress-Hormone-Blood Sugar Triangle

Stress is another significant yet often underestimated factor affecting blood sugar levels. When you experience stress, your body activates the "fight or flight" response, leading to the release of stress hormones like cortisol and adrenaline. These hormones provide you with a surge of energy to deal with the perceived threat, but they also cause your blood sugar to rise.

How Stress Impacts Blood Sugar:

  • Hormonal Release: Cortisol and adrenaline signal the liver to release stored glucose into the bloodstream.
  • Insulin Resistance: Chronic stress can lead to insulin resistance, making it harder for your cells to use glucose effectively.
  • Unhealthy Coping Mechanisms: Many people turn to unhealthy coping mechanisms like overeating, consuming sugary foods, or skipping exercise when stressed, further exacerbating blood sugar control.

Real-World Examples:

Imagine you have a big presentation at work. The stress leading up to the presentation can cause your blood sugar to spike. Similarly, emotional distress following a personal event, such as a family argument, can also significantly impact your blood sugar levels.

Effective Stress Management Techniques:

  • Mindfulness Meditation: Practicing mindfulness can help you become more aware of your thoughts and feelings, allowing you to manage stress more effectively.
  • Regular Exercise: Physical activity is a great way to relieve stress and improve insulin sensitivity.
  • Deep Breathing Exercises: Simple breathing exercises can help calm your nervous system and reduce stress hormones.
  • Yoga and Tai Chi: These practices combine physical activity with mindfulness, offering both stress relief and improved physical health.
  • Seek Social Support: Talking to friends, family, or a therapist can provide emotional support and help you cope with stress.

3. Dehydration

The Hydration-Blood Volume-Blood Sugar Link

Dehydration can have a direct impact on blood sugar levels. When you are dehydrated, the concentration of glucose in your blood increases because there is less water to dilute it. This can lead to higher blood sugar readings.

How Dehydration Impacts Blood Sugar:

  • Increased Glucose Concentration: Less water in the bloodstream results in a higher glucose concentration.
  • Impaired Kidney Function: Dehydration can strain your kidneys, which play a crucial role in filtering glucose from the blood.
  • Reduced Insulin Sensitivity: Some studies suggest that dehydration can also reduce insulin sensitivity, making it harder for your body to use glucose effectively.

Practical Tips:

  • Drink plenty of water throughout the day. Aim for at least eight glasses of water daily.
  • Monitor your urine color. Light-colored urine is a good indicator of adequate hydration.
  • Increase fluid intake during exercise and hot weather.
  • Choose hydrating foods. Fruits and vegetables like watermelon, cucumbers, and spinach have high water content.
  • Avoid sugary drinks. These can worsen dehydration and cause blood sugar spikes.

Data Example:

A study published in the Journal of Diabetes Research found that individuals who drank more water throughout the day had better blood sugar control compared to those who were chronically dehydrated.

4. Artificial Sweeteners

The Sweet Deception?

While often marketed as a blood sugar-friendly alternative to sugar, artificial sweeteners can have surprising effects on blood sugar levels and overall health. While they don't directly raise blood sugar, they can indirectly influence it through various mechanisms.

How Artificial Sweeteners Might Impact Blood Sugar:

  • Gut Microbiome Disruption: Some studies suggest that artificial sweeteners can alter the composition of the gut microbiome, which can impact glucose metabolism and insulin sensitivity.
  • Increased Cravings: Artificial sweeteners may stimulate sweet taste receptors, leading to increased cravings for sugary foods and drinks.
  • Insulin Response: Although artificial sweeteners don't contain calories, some research indicates they can still trigger an insulin response in certain individuals.
  • Compensatory Eating: People might consume more calories from other sources, thinking they are saving calories by using artificial sweeteners.

Research Considerations:

Research on artificial sweeteners is ongoing and the results are mixed. Some studies have found no significant impact on blood sugar levels, while others have reported adverse effects. It's crucial to consider the type of sweetener, dosage, and individual differences when interpreting these findings.

Healthy Alternatives:

If you're looking for a healthier way to sweeten your food and beverages, consider using natural sweeteners in moderation, such as:

  • Stevia: A natural sweetener derived from the stevia plant.
  • Erythritol: A sugar alcohol with a minimal impact on blood sugar.
  • Monk Fruit: A natural sweetener derived from the monk fruit.

5. Certain Medications

Unintended Side Effects

Certain medications can significantly affect blood sugar levels as a side effect. It's essential to be aware of these potential interactions and discuss them with your healthcare provider.

Common Medications That Can Affect Blood Sugar:

  • Corticosteroids (e.g., Prednisone): These anti-inflammatory drugs can increase blood sugar levels by decreasing insulin sensitivity and stimulating glucose production in the liver.
  • Diuretics: Some diuretics can raise blood sugar by affecting potassium levels, which play a role in insulin secretion.
  • Beta-Blockers: These medications, commonly used to treat high blood pressure and heart conditions, can mask the symptoms of hypoglycemia and interfere with blood sugar control.
  • Antipsychotics: Certain antipsychotic medications can increase insulin resistance and the risk of developing type 2 diabetes.

Strategies for Managing Medication-Related Blood Sugar Changes:

  • Regular Blood Sugar Monitoring: If you are taking medications that can affect blood sugar, monitor your levels more frequently.
  • Adjusting Medication Dosage: Your healthcare provider may need to adjust your diabetes medication dosage to compensate for the effects of other medications.
  • Lifestyle Modifications: Adopting healthy lifestyle habits, such as a balanced diet and regular exercise, can help mitigate the impact of medications on blood sugar.

Data Insight:

According to the American Diabetes Association, certain medications are known to increase the risk of hyperglycemia, highlighting the importance of regular monitoring and communication with your healthcare provider.
